What to Consider When Selecting the Best Meal Prep Containers

When it comes to optimizing your meal prep routine, choosing the right containers is key. Here’s what to keep in mind to find the best meal prep containers for your needs:

✔️ Material Choices:

The main contenders are glass, plastic, and stainless steel. Glass containers are durable and don’t retain odors or stains but can be heavy and breakable. Plastic options are cost-effective and lightweight but may stain or hold odors over time, and there’s often concern about microwaving. Stainless steel stands out for its durability and longevity, though it cannot be used in the microwave. Depending on what you prioritize—durability, weight, or microwave use—your choice of material will vary. Glass often emerges as a versatile favorite for its longevity and ease of cleaning.

✔️ Container Shape:

Rectangular containers are popular for their stackability and efficient use of space. Round containers might fit less neatly into some spaces but could be just what you need depending on your bag or fridge layout. Containers with dividers offer convenient portion control, though they may not suit everyone’s needs depending on what you’re packing.

✔️ Size Matters:

For single servings, consistent-sized containers that stack well are ideal. If your meal prep varies in portion size or you prefer cooking in batches, look for sets with a variety of sizes. Even if some containers seem impractical for daily transport, having multiple sizes ensures you’ll find a few that are just right for your needs.

✔️ Seal and Leak Protection:

More containers now come with clasps or seals for added leak protection, which is great for soups or saucy dishes. However, these can make the containers bulkier. Press-down lids might be slimmer and easier to store but check for a good, leak-proof fit to avoid spills.

✔️ Versatility Is Key:

The best meal prep containers are those that can go from freezer to microwave or even oven without issue. Look for containers that are safe for all the ways you like to store, reheat, and sometimes cook your meals. Glass containers often lead in this category for their ability to withstand a range of temperatures without transferring chemicals to food.

Choosing the right meal prep containers involves balancing these factors to suit your lifestyle, preferences, and the types of meals you prepare. Whether you opt for glass, plastic, or stainless steel, consider how the shape, size, seal, and versatility will impact your meal prepping success.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Meal Prep Containers

Is it better to meal prep in glass or plastic containers?

The choice between glass and plastic meal prep containers depends on your personal preferences and needs. Glass containers are durable, non-porous, and do not absorb stains or odors. They are also environmentally friendly and can be used in ovens and microwaves without worry. However, they tend to be heavier and more fragile than plastic. Plastic containers, on the other hand, are lightweight, often cheaper, and more resistant to breaking. If choosing plastic, look for BPA-free options to ensure food safety. For those concerned with sustainability and long-term durability, glass is the better choice, whereas plastic containers offer convenience and portability for on-the-go meals.

Can you microwave meal prep containers?

Whether a meal prep container is microwave-safe depends on its material. Most glass containers are microwave-safe, making them a convenient choice for reheating meals. Many plastic containers are also designed to be microwave-safe, but it’s important to check for a microwave-safe symbol or confirmation from the manufacturer. It’s recommended to remove lids, especially if they are made of plastic, to prevent any chemical leaching or damage to the container. Silicone containers are generally safe for microwave use as well. Always verify the manufacturer’s guidelines to ensure safe and proper use.

How long do meal prep containers last?

The lifespan of Ideal Meal Containers varies based on the material, quality, and how they are used and cared for. High-quality glass containers can last for many years, especially if they are handled carefully and not subjected to sudden temperature changes. Plastic containers may show wear and tear sooner, especially if frequently used in microwaves and dishwashers, with an average lifespan of 1-3 years depending on the quality.

How do you properly clean meal prep containers?

Proper cleaning of meal prep containers is crucial for hygiene and longevity. Glass, stainless steel, and most plastic containers can typically be washed in the dishwasher, although hand washing might preserve their quality longer. Use warm, soapy water and a soft sponge or brush to avoid scratching the surface.
